site stats

Format_message_allocate_buffer

WebJun 8, 2024 · The pFinalMessage buffer will contain // the completed parameter substitution. pTempMessage = (LPWSTR)pMessage; cbBuffer = (wcslen (pMessage) + cchParameters + 1) * sizeof (WCHAR); pFinalMessage = (LPWSTR)malloc (cbBuffer); if (NULL == pFinalMessage) { wprintf (L"Failed to allocate memory for pFinalMessage.\n"); … Within the message text, several escape sequences are supported for dynamically formatting the message. Theseescape sequences and their meanings are shown in the following tables. All escape sequences start with the percentcharacter (%). Any other nondigit character following a percent character is formatted in … See more [in] dwFlags The formatting options, and how to interpret the lpSource parameter. Thelow-order byte of dwFlagsspecifies how the function handles line breaks in the outputbuffer. The low-order byte can also specify the maximum … See more If the function succeeds, the return value is the number of TCHARsstored in theoutput buffer, excluding the terminating null character. If the function fails, the return value is zero. To get extended error information, … See more

윈도우2 - ydhan

WebDec 15, 2024 · LPVOID lpMsgBuf; FormatMessage( FORMAT_MESSAGE_ALLOCATE_BUFFER FORMAT_MESSAGE_FROM_SYSTEM, NULL, err, MAKELANGID (LANG_NEUTRAL, SUBLANG_DEFAULT), (LPTSTR)&lpMsgBuf, 0, … WebEnum Format_Message FORMAT_MESSAGE_ALLOCATE_BUFFER = &H100 'The caller should use the LocalFree function to free the buffer when it is no longer needed … fhir interoperability cms https://carsbehindbook.com

FormatMessage function (winbase.h) - Win32 apps

WebJun 23, 2009 · At first you have to convert GetLastError() to string by using FormatMessage(). Then display it by calling MessageBox() properly. Have a look at … WebTo obtain a descriptive error message ( e.g., to display to a user), you can call FormatMessage: // This functions fills a caller-defined character buffer (pBuffer) // of max length (cchBufferLength) with the human-readable error message // for a Win32 error code (dwErrorCode). // // Returns TRUE if successful, or FALSE otherwise. WebC if (FormatMessageA (FORMAT_MESSAGE_ALLOCATE_BUFFER . PreviousNext. This tutorial shows you how to use FormatMessageA. FormatMessageA is defined in header … fhir integration

C if (!FormatMessage(FORMAT_MESSAGE_FROM_HMODULE

Category:Using the FormatMessage Function - Learning DCOM [Book]

Tags:Format_message_allocate_buffer

Format_message_allocate_buffer

Using the FormatMessage Function - Learning DCOM [Book]

Web$FORMAT_MESSAGE_ALLOCATE_BUFFER = 0x1000 } PROCESS { foreach ( $Id in $MessageIDs) { $Result = [ Win32Native ]::FormatMessage ( ( … WebMay 28, 2014 · FormatMessage does not appear to work that way. You can either either let FormatMessage allocate a buffer for you, or pass in your own buffer. But you have to know how big the buffer has to be in the first place. Without a way to do a "dry run" you have to use the maximum size of 64K.

Format_message_allocate_buffer

Did you know?

Web1 2 3 4 5 6 7 8 $format_message_flags = psenum $module format_message_flags uint32 @{ format_message_allocate_buffer = 0x00000100 format_message_ignore_inserts ... WebMar 5, 2024 · FORMAT_MESSAGE_FROM_SYSTEM or FORMAT_MESSAGE_FROM_HMODULE here unrelated. function really not return …

WebMay 28, 2014 · FormatMessage does not appear to work that way. You can either either let FormatMessage allocate a buffer for you, or pass in your own buffer. But you have to … http://www.flounder.com/formatmessage.htm

WebMay 30, 2024 · The flag FORMAT_MESSAGE_ALLOCATE_BUFFER causes FormatMessage to allocate memory. This memory should be released by the LocalFree function afterward to avoid a leak. If a developer is not very familiar with the Windows API, it is easy to forget this point. Also, it is worth mentioning that C++ Runtime won’t report … WebAug 12, 2024 · FormatMessage also allows you to specify the language of the string you want to retrieve from a message table. LoadString can retrieve only resources …

WebIf FORMAT_MESSAGE_ALLOCATE_BUFFER is set, this parameter specifies the minimum number of bytes or characters to allocate for an output buffer. Arguments …

WebAug 5, 2024 · The Windows 10 SDK came with an updated version of WACK that permitted the FORMAT_MESSAGE_ALLOCATE_BUFFER flag to be used. Furthermore, the … fhir introduction pptWebMar 19, 2024 · VirtualAlloc => if lpAddress parameter is NULL, the system determines where to allocate the region. Using VirtualQuery, if you specify a NULL pointer for lpAddress you get: BaseAddress 0x00000000 void * AllocationBase 0x00000000 void * AllocationProtect 0 unsigned long RegionSize 9175040 unsigned long State 65536 … department of justice ni contactWebMar 16, 2024 · Mar 17, 2024, 3:41 AM let chars = FormatMessageW ( FORMAT_MESSAGE_ALLOCATE_BUFFER FORMAT_MESSAGE_FROM_SYSTEM FORMAT_MESSAGE_IGNORE_INSERTS, None, message, 0, PWSTR (&mut text.0 as *mut _ as *mut _), 0,None); if chars > 0 { let parts = std::slice::from_raw_parts (text.0, … department of justice nova scotia addressWebApr 12, 2024 · Estimate and allocate the time. The third step is to estimate and allocate the time for each agenda item based on its category, rank, and content. You can use a formula or a tool to calculate the ... department of justice nsw wikiWebDec 9, 2024 · DWORD flags = FORMAT_MESSAGE_ALLOCATE_BUFFER FORMAT_MESSAGE_IGNORE_INSERTS FORMAT_MESSAGE_FROM_SYSTEM; … fhir ipaWebValue Meaning; FORMAT_MESSAGE_ALLOCATE_BUFFER: Specifies that the lpBuffer parameter is a pointer to a PVOID pointer, and that the nSize parameter specifies the … fhir interoperabilityWebUsing serial. The following is a sample code that redirects all traffic between a serial port and a local socket port. It works for me, but YMMV. Run from Lua command prompt. The outer while loop is to allow repeated reconnects by an ip client without having to restart the script. local s= require "socket" local com= require "serial" if arg [1 ... fhir is a standard for